Compare commits
merge into: jihoson:main
jihoson:main
jihoson:feature/issue-tkt-p1-004-walkforward-purge-embargo
jihoson:feature/v3-session-policy-stream
jihoson:feature/issue-tkt-p1-001-fx-buffer-guard
jihoson:feature/issue-tkt-p1-003-triple-barrier-labeler
jihoson:feature/issue-tkt-p0-002-killswitch-ordering
jihoson:feature/issue-tkt-p0-001-blackout-queue-revalidate
jihoson:feature/issue-279-session-order-policy-guard
jihoson:feature/issue-277-tpm-priority-main-ideation-no-merge-session
jihoson:feature/issue-275-phase1-state-exit-killswitch
jihoson:feature/issue-273-multi-agent-governance-docs
jihoson:feature/issue-271-docs-routing-validation
jihoson:feature/issue-269-overseas-cash-ovrs-ord-psbl-amt
jihoson:feature/issue-267-fix-log-warnings
jihoson:feature/issue-264-265-overseas-cash-and-open-position
jihoson:feature/issue-259-market-data-pnl-holding-days
jihoson:feature/issue-261-fix-mock-settings-mode
jihoson:feature/issue-258-ranking-api-keyb-param
jihoson:feature/issue-256-fix-overnight-live-mode
jihoson:feature/issue-254-cleanup-paper-data
jihoson:feature/issue-251-252-trading-cycle-guards
jihoson:feature/issue-249-avg-price-sync
jihoson:feature/issue-247-skip-parse-response-on-prompt-override
jihoson:feature/issue-245-parse-response-preserve-raw
jihoson:feature/issue-242-243-gemini-key-fix-overseas-scanner
jihoson:feature/issue-240-kr-scanner-rank-param-fix
jihoson:feature/issue-237-dashboard-mode-badge-fix
jihoson:feature/issue-237-dashboard-mode-badge
jihoson:feature/issue-235-overseas-balance-ord-psbl-qty
jihoson:feature/issue-232-domestic-limit-order-pending
jihoson:feature/issue-229-overseas-pending-order-handling
jihoson:feature/issue-211-overseas-limit-price-policy
jihoson:feature/issue-206-startup-position-sync
jihoson:feature/issue-207-daily-cb-pnl
jihoson:feature/issue-218-live-trading-docs
jihoson:feature/issue-217-gemini-model-default
jihoson:feature/issue-215-evolved-strategy-syntax
jihoson:feature/issue-209-daily-connection-retry
jihoson:feature/issue-204-test-coverage-80
jihoson:feature/issue-212-trades-mode-column
jihoson:feature/issue-201-202-203-broker-live-mode
jihoson:feature/issue-210-213-216-db-wal-env-fix
jihoson:feature/issue-195-overseas-double-buy-prevention
jihoson:feature/issue-198-dashboard-api-frontend
jihoson:feature/issue-196-cb-gauge
jihoson:feature/issue-193-dashboard-positions
jihoson:feature/issue-191-duplicate-buy-fix
jihoson:feature/issue-189-overseas-sell-tr-id-fix
jihoson:feature/issue-187-sell-fat-finger-fix
jihoson:feature/issue-180-telegram-instance-lock
jihoson:feature/issue-181-implied-rsi-saturation
jihoson:feature/issue-178-dashboard-log-order
jihoson:feature/issue-179-insufficient-balance-cooldown
jihoson:feature/issue-173-market-outlook-threshold
jihoson:feature/issue-172-playbook-allocation-sizing
jihoson:feature/issue-171-position-aware-conditions
jihoson:feature/issue-170-holdings-in-prompt
jihoson:feature/issue-164-165-broker-api-holdings
jihoson:feature/issue-165-holdings-in-trading-loop
jihoson:feature/issue-164-sell-quantity-fix
jihoson:feature/issue-163-take-profit-enforcement
jihoson:feature/issue-161-telegram-notification-filters
jihoson:feature/issue-159-dashboard-ui-improvement
jihoson:feature/issue-157-fix-domestic-price-and-tick
jihoson:feature/issue-155-fix-ranking-api
jihoson:feature/issue-153-kr-fallback-stocks
jihoson:feature/issue-151-overseas-order-fixes
jihoson:feature/issue-149-overseas-limit-order-price
jihoson:feature/issue-147-overseas-price-balance-fix
jihoson:feature/issue-145-smart-fallback-playbook
jihoson:feature/issue-143-fix-prompt-override
jihoson:feature/issue-141-fix-overseas-ranking-api
jihoson:fix/137-run-overnight-python-tmux
jihoson:feat/overseas-ranking-current-state
jihoson:feature/issue-131-docs-v2-status-sync
jihoson:feature/issue-132-us-market-telegram-gaps
jihoson:feature/issue-129-fix-daily-review-test-date
jihoson:feature/issue-97-dashboard-integration
jihoson:feature/issue-96-evolution-main-integration
jihoson:feature/issue-95-evolution-loop
jihoson:feature/issue-89-legacy-context-cleanup
jihoson:feature/issue-94-planner-scorecard-injection
jihoson:feat/v2-2-4-planner-context-crossmarket
jihoson:feature/issue-93-daily-review-integration
jihoson:feature/issue-91-daily-reviewer
jihoson:feature/issue-92-decision-outcome
jihoson:feature/issue-87-context-scheduler
jihoson:feature/issue-90-scorecard-model
jihoson:feature/issue-86-eod-market-filter
jihoson:feature/issue-85-l7-context-write
jihoson:feature/issue-114-review-plan-consistency
jihoson:fix/test-failures
jihoson:feature/issue-84-main-integration
jihoson:feature/issue-83-pre-market-planner
jihoson:feature/issue-81-telegram-playbook-notify
jihoson:feature/issue-82-playbook-persistence
jihoson:feature/issue-80-scenario-engine
jihoson:feature/issue-105-branch-rebase
jihoson:feature/issue-100-agent-constraints
jihoson:feature/issue-79-strategy-models
jihoson:feature/issue-78-config-watchlist-removal
jihoson:feature/issue-76-smart-volatility-scanner
jihoson:feature/issue-74-telegram-command-fix
jihoson:fix/start-command-parsing
jihoson:feature/issue-69-config-docs
jihoson:feature/issue-67-status-commands
jihoson:feature/issue-65-trading-control
jihoson:feature/issue-63-basic-commands
jihoson:feature/issue-61-command-handler
jihoson:feature/issue-59-send-message
jihoson:feature/issue-57-daily-trading-mode
jihoson:feature/issue-49-valueerror-empty-string
jihoson:feature/issue-52-aiohttp-cleanup
jihoson:feature/issue-54-token-refresh-cooldown
jihoson:feature/issue-51-api-rate-limiting
jihoson:feature/issue-44-safe-float
jihoson:feature/issue-43-reduce-rate-limit
jihoson:feature/issue-42-token-refresh-lock
jihoson:feature/issue-41-keyerror-balance
jihoson:feature/issue-35-telegram-docs
jihoson:feature/issue-34-main-integration
jihoson:feature/issue-33-telegram-config
jihoson:feature/issue-32-telegram-tests
jihoson:feature/issue-31-telegram-client
jihoson:feature/issue-23-sustainability
jihoson:feature/issue-22-data-driven
jihoson:feature/issue-24-token-efficiency
jihoson:feature/issue-21-latency-control
jihoson:feature/issue-19-evolution-engine
jihoson:feature/issue-20-volatility-hunter
jihoson:feature/issue-17-decision-logging
jihoson:feature/issue-15-context-tree
jihoson:feature/issue-13-docs-refactor
jihoson:feature/issue-11-command-failures
jihoson:feature/issue-9-agent-workflow
jihoson:feature/issue-5-global-market-auto-selection
jihoson:feature/issue-4-add-git-workflow-policy
jihoson:feature/issue-2-add-claude-md
...
pull from: jihoson:main
jihoson:feature/issue-tkt-p1-004-walkforward-purge-embargo
jihoson:feature/v3-session-policy-stream
jihoson:feature/issue-tkt-p1-001-fx-buffer-guard
jihoson:feature/issue-tkt-p1-003-triple-barrier-labeler
jihoson:feature/issue-tkt-p0-002-killswitch-ordering
jihoson:feature/issue-tkt-p0-001-blackout-queue-revalidate
jihoson:feature/issue-279-session-order-policy-guard
jihoson:main
jihoson:feature/issue-277-tpm-priority-main-ideation-no-merge-session
jihoson:feature/issue-275-phase1-state-exit-killswitch
jihoson:feature/issue-273-multi-agent-governance-docs
jihoson:feature/issue-271-docs-routing-validation
jihoson:feature/issue-269-overseas-cash-ovrs-ord-psbl-amt
jihoson:feature/issue-267-fix-log-warnings
jihoson:feature/issue-264-265-overseas-cash-and-open-position
jihoson:feature/issue-259-market-data-pnl-holding-days
jihoson:feature/issue-261-fix-mock-settings-mode
jihoson:feature/issue-258-ranking-api-keyb-param
jihoson:feature/issue-256-fix-overnight-live-mode
jihoson:feature/issue-254-cleanup-paper-data
jihoson:feature/issue-251-252-trading-cycle-guards
jihoson:feature/issue-249-avg-price-sync
jihoson:feature/issue-247-skip-parse-response-on-prompt-override
jihoson:feature/issue-245-parse-response-preserve-raw
jihoson:feature/issue-242-243-gemini-key-fix-overseas-scanner
jihoson:feature/issue-240-kr-scanner-rank-param-fix
jihoson:feature/issue-237-dashboard-mode-badge-fix
jihoson:feature/issue-237-dashboard-mode-badge
jihoson:feature/issue-235-overseas-balance-ord-psbl-qty
jihoson:feature/issue-232-domestic-limit-order-pending
jihoson:feature/issue-229-overseas-pending-order-handling
jihoson:feature/issue-211-overseas-limit-price-policy
jihoson:feature/issue-206-startup-position-sync
jihoson:feature/issue-207-daily-cb-pnl
jihoson:feature/issue-218-live-trading-docs
jihoson:feature/issue-217-gemini-model-default
jihoson:feature/issue-215-evolved-strategy-syntax
jihoson:feature/issue-209-daily-connection-retry
jihoson:feature/issue-204-test-coverage-80
jihoson:feature/issue-212-trades-mode-column
jihoson:feature/issue-201-202-203-broker-live-mode
jihoson:feature/issue-210-213-216-db-wal-env-fix
jihoson:feature/issue-195-overseas-double-buy-prevention
jihoson:feature/issue-198-dashboard-api-frontend
jihoson:feature/issue-196-cb-gauge
jihoson:feature/issue-193-dashboard-positions
jihoson:feature/issue-191-duplicate-buy-fix
jihoson:feature/issue-189-overseas-sell-tr-id-fix
jihoson:feature/issue-187-sell-fat-finger-fix
jihoson:feature/issue-180-telegram-instance-lock
jihoson:feature/issue-181-implied-rsi-saturation
jihoson:feature/issue-178-dashboard-log-order
jihoson:feature/issue-179-insufficient-balance-cooldown
jihoson:feature/issue-173-market-outlook-threshold
jihoson:feature/issue-172-playbook-allocation-sizing
jihoson:feature/issue-171-position-aware-conditions
jihoson:feature/issue-170-holdings-in-prompt
jihoson:feature/issue-164-165-broker-api-holdings
jihoson:feature/issue-165-holdings-in-trading-loop
jihoson:feature/issue-164-sell-quantity-fix
jihoson:feature/issue-163-take-profit-enforcement
jihoson:feature/issue-161-telegram-notification-filters
jihoson:feature/issue-159-dashboard-ui-improvement
jihoson:feature/issue-157-fix-domestic-price-and-tick
jihoson:feature/issue-155-fix-ranking-api
jihoson:feature/issue-153-kr-fallback-stocks
jihoson:feature/issue-151-overseas-order-fixes
jihoson:feature/issue-149-overseas-limit-order-price
jihoson:feature/issue-147-overseas-price-balance-fix
jihoson:feature/issue-145-smart-fallback-playbook
jihoson:feature/issue-143-fix-prompt-override
jihoson:feature/issue-141-fix-overseas-ranking-api
jihoson:fix/137-run-overnight-python-tmux
jihoson:feat/overseas-ranking-current-state
jihoson:feature/issue-131-docs-v2-status-sync
jihoson:feature/issue-132-us-market-telegram-gaps
jihoson:feature/issue-129-fix-daily-review-test-date
jihoson:feature/issue-97-dashboard-integration
jihoson:feature/issue-96-evolution-main-integration
jihoson:feature/issue-95-evolution-loop
jihoson:feature/issue-89-legacy-context-cleanup
jihoson:feature/issue-94-planner-scorecard-injection
jihoson:feat/v2-2-4-planner-context-crossmarket
jihoson:feature/issue-93-daily-review-integration
jihoson:feature/issue-91-daily-reviewer
jihoson:feature/issue-92-decision-outcome
jihoson:feature/issue-87-context-scheduler
jihoson:feature/issue-90-scorecard-model
jihoson:feature/issue-86-eod-market-filter
jihoson:feature/issue-85-l7-context-write
jihoson:feature/issue-114-review-plan-consistency
jihoson:fix/test-failures
jihoson:feature/issue-84-main-integration
jihoson:feature/issue-83-pre-market-planner
jihoson:feature/issue-81-telegram-playbook-notify
jihoson:feature/issue-82-playbook-persistence
jihoson:feature/issue-80-scenario-engine
jihoson:feature/issue-105-branch-rebase
jihoson:feature/issue-100-agent-constraints
jihoson:feature/issue-79-strategy-models
jihoson:feature/issue-78-config-watchlist-removal
jihoson:feature/issue-76-smart-volatility-scanner
jihoson:feature/issue-74-telegram-command-fix
jihoson:fix/start-command-parsing
jihoson:feature/issue-69-config-docs
jihoson:feature/issue-67-status-commands
jihoson:feature/issue-65-trading-control
jihoson:feature/issue-63-basic-commands
jihoson:feature/issue-61-command-handler
jihoson:feature/issue-59-send-message
jihoson:feature/issue-57-daily-trading-mode
jihoson:feature/issue-49-valueerror-empty-string
jihoson:feature/issue-52-aiohttp-cleanup
jihoson:feature/issue-54-token-refresh-cooldown
jihoson:feature/issue-51-api-rate-limiting
jihoson:feature/issue-44-safe-float
jihoson:feature/issue-43-reduce-rate-limit
jihoson:feature/issue-42-token-refresh-lock
jihoson:feature/issue-41-keyerror-balance
jihoson:feature/issue-35-telegram-docs
jihoson:feature/issue-34-main-integration
jihoson:feature/issue-33-telegram-config
jihoson:feature/issue-32-telegram-tests
jihoson:feature/issue-31-telegram-client
jihoson:feature/issue-23-sustainability
jihoson:feature/issue-22-data-driven
jihoson:feature/issue-24-token-efficiency
jihoson:feature/issue-21-latency-control
jihoson:feature/issue-19-evolution-engine
jihoson:feature/issue-20-volatility-hunter
jihoson:feature/issue-17-decision-logging
jihoson:feature/issue-15-context-tree
jihoson:feature/issue-13-docs-refactor
jihoson:feature/issue-11-command-failures
jihoson:feature/issue-9-agent-workflow
jihoson:feature/issue-5-global-market-auto-selection
jihoson:feature/issue-4-add-git-workflow-policy
jihoson:feature/issue-2-add-claude-md
These branches are equal.